Ukuqonda i-NMN: Okudingeka Ukwazi

Kuyini i-β-Nicotinamide Mononucleotide?

I-β-Nicotinamide mononucleotide, eyaziwa kakhulu ngokuthi i-NMN, iyi-molecule eyenzeka ngokwemvelo etholakala kuwo wonke amaseli aphilayo. Idlala indima ebalulekile ekukhiqizweni kwe-nicotinamide adenine dinucleotide (NAD+), i-coenzyme ebalulekile ezinqubweni ezahlukahlukene zamaseli, okuhlanganisa i-metabolism yamandla kanye nokulungiswa kwe-DNA. Njengoba siguga, amazinga ethu e-NAD+ ayancipha ngokwemvelo, okuholele abacwaningi ukuthi bahlole ukwengezwa kwe-NMN njengendlela engaba khona yokukhulisa amazinga e-NAD+ nokukhuthaza ukuguga okunempilo.

Isayensi Engemuva kwe-NMN

I-β-Nicotinamide mononucleotide isebenza ngokusebenza njengesandulela se-NAD+. Uma igwinywa, i-NMN iguqulwa ngokushesha ibe yi-NAD+ emzimbeni, okwandisa amazinga e-NAD+ yeselula ngempumelelo. Lokhu kwanda kwe-NAD+ kuhlotshaniswe nezinzuzo eziningi ezingaba khona, okuhlanganisa ukusebenza kwe-mitochondrial okuthuthukisiwe, ukukhiqizwa kwamandla eselula okuthuthukisiwe, kanye nokusekelwa kwezindlela zokulungisa i-DNA. Ucwaningo kumamodeli ezilwane lubonise imiphumela ethembisayo, kanye nokwengezwa kwe-NMN okubonisa imiphumela emihle ezicini ezahlukene zempilo nokuguga.

Iphrofayili Yokuphepha ye-NMN: Lokho Ucwaningo Olusitshela Khona

Izifundo Zezokwelapha Ngokuphepha Kwe-NMN

Ukuphepha kwe-β-Nicotinamide mononucleotide kube yisihloko sezifundo eziningi, kokubili kumamodeli ezilwane kanye nasezivivinyweni zabantu. Ukubuyekezwa okuphelele kwalezi zifundo kusikisela ukuthi i-NMN ngokuvamile ibekezelelwa kahle uma isetshenziswa njengoba kuqondiswe. Isivivinyo esisodwa esiphawulekayo somtholampilo kubantu, esanyatheliswa ephephabhukwini elithi "Nature," asitholanga miphumela emibi ebalulekile kubahlanganyeli abathathe izithasiselo ze-NMN amasonto ayi-10. Lolu cwaningo lunikeze ukuqonda okubalulekile ngephrofayili yokuphepha ye-NMN kubantu, okuqinisa amandla ayo njengenketho yezithasiselo eziphephile.

Izinto Okufanele Uzicabangele Ngokuphepha Kwesikhathi Eside

Nakuba izifundo zesikhashana ku-β-Nicotinamide mononucleotide zibonise imiphumela ethembisayo ngokuphepha, idatha yokuphepha yesikhathi eside isalinganiselwe. Njenganoma yisiphi isengezo, kubalulekile ukubhekana nokusetshenziswa kwe-NMN ngokuqapha nangaphansi kwesiqondiso somhlinzeki wezempilo. Ucwaningo oluqhubekayo luyaqhubeka nokuphenya imiphumela yesikhathi eside yesengezo se-NMN, esizohlinzeka ngemininingwane ephelele ngephrofayili yayo yokuphepha esikhathini eside sokusetshenziswa.

Isilinganiso Esifanele Nokuphathwa Kwaso

Umthamo ofanele we-β-Nicotinamide mononucleotide ungahluka kuye ngezici ngazinye njengobudala, isisindo, kanye nesimo sempilo. Nakuba kungekho mthamo ovunyelwene ngawo wonke umuntu, izifundo eziningi zisebenzise imithamo esukela ku-250mg kuya ku-500mg ngosuku. Kubalulekile ukulandela imiyalelo yomthamo enikezwe umenzi noma njengoba kunconywe umhlinzeki wakho wezempilo.

Uma kukhulunywa ngokusetshenziswa, izithasiselo ze-β-Nicotinamide mononucleotide zivame ukutholakala ngesimo sempuphu noma se-capsule. Amanye amathiphu okusetshenziswa okufanele afaka:

  • • Phuza i-NMN ngamanzi noma njengoba kuqondiswe kwilebula lomkhiqizo.
  • • Cabanga ngokuthatha i-NMN esiswini esingenalutho ukuze umunce kahle, ngaphandle uma kunikezwe iseluleko esihlukile.
  • • Hlala uhambisana nesimiso sakho sokwengeza ukuze ugcine amazinga azinzile ohlelweni lwakho.

Ukuxhumana Okungenzeka Nemithi

Nakuba i-β-Nicotinamide mononucleotide ngokuvamile ibhekwa njengephephile, kubalulekile ukuqaphela ukusebenzisana okungenzeka nemithi ethile. I-NMN ingase ixhumane nalokhu:

  • • Izinto zokunciphisa igazi
  • • Imithi yesifo sikashukela
  • • Imithi yokucindezeleka kwegazi

Uma uthatha noma yimiphi imithi kadokotela, kubalulekile ukubonisana nomhlinzeki wakho wezempilo ngaphambi kokuqala ukwengezwa kwe-NMN. Bangakunikeza iseluleko esiqondene nawe ngokusekelwe emlandweni wakho wezokwelapha kanye nohlelo lwemithi lwamanje.
